Benefit Analysis on Continuous Construction of Water Saving Innovation Projects in Baojixia Irrigation Area

During eight years from 1998 to 2005, China had carried out continuous construction of main and branch irrigation channels and related buildings, as well as water-saving innovation projects in Baojixia Irrigation Area stage by stage. Along with the completion and operation of these annual new projects, the appearance of irrigation constructions had been improved obviously to a certain extent, which has gradually present the benefits on engineering disaster-reducing, economy, water-saving and ecological aspect. Based on tracing investigation and operation tests, it show that projects maintenance fees and accidents compensation have step down, food yield has increased gradually; water irrigation efficiency and water-saving amounts has rise continuously, furthermore, ecological environment has been improved. Therefore, to a certain extent, water shortage in the irrigation area has been mitigated; consequently, rural economic development has been speed up in the irrigation area rapidly and sustainably.
